Reverse Warrior (Viparita Virabhadrasana) Verywell / Ben Goldstein. Come into Reverse Warrior by raising your right arm overhead and letting your left arm slide down the left leg. Try to keep a light touch on the left leg instead of resting all your weight there. The front knee stays stacked on top of the ankle as you breathe deeply into this.

Stretches, Strengthens, Lengthens: The position of legs in the Reverse Warrior Pose nicely stretches the hamstrings, groins, quadriceps, and gluteus, and strengthens the knees, hips, and ankles. As a backbend, Viparita Virabhadrasana stretches the chest, rib cage, abdominal area, intercostal muscles, neck, arms, and psoas muscles.

Reverse Warrior is a tricky pose that strengthens the quads and hips and stretches the sides of the body as well as the calves and hamstrings. REVERSE WARRIOR BENEFITS. Strengthens the feet, ankles, knees, quads, hips and glutes. Stretches the calves, hamstrings, groin, adductors, hip flexors, obliques, intercostals, chest and shoulders.

Keep the bend in your front knee. Lengthen the sides of your torso with every inhale, strengthen your legs with every exhale. If it's comfortable for your neck, turn your gaze up to the fingertips of your right hand. Soften your shoulders down your back. Hold for 3-5 breaths, then release to warrior II.
